Free in-product survey tool
In-Product Surveys for Your SaaS
Launch in-product surveys that meet users right when they have something to say
Trigger microsurveys based on user actions and attributes. No more random pop-ups that get ignored.
Modern analytics, not clunky dashboards
In-product surveys that look like your brand

Set up in-product surveys in 15 minutes
One script tag. No backend changes. Launch and update surveys from the dashboard without code deploys.
01
Install the widget
Add one JavaScript snippet to your app - the same way you add Intercom or Mixpanel. Pass user identity (plan, role, any custom attributes) through the widget config.
02
Set behavioral triggers
Define when surveys appear: after a feature is used, after a session time threshold, on exit intent, or via custom JS event. Surveys fire when users actually have context.
03
Collect segmented responses
Every response is linked to a real user. Filter NPS, CSAT, or PMF scores by plan, role, region, or any attribute you passed through - not anonymous averages.
Trigger Surveys When Users Actually Care
Personalize and trigger surveys based on user attributes and actions like right after they use a feature, not before or a week after. No more random pop-ups that get ignored.
Email surveys
5-15% response rate
Days to collect feedback
No context on what they were doing
Anonymous responses
In-product surveys
30-50% response rate
Feedback in real time
Capture feedback in context
Linked to user identity
Trigger Surveys at the Right Moment
Get real, contextually relevant answers by catching your users at the precise moment. Choose from popular triggers or add your own custom JavaScript code.
Time spent on page
Show the survey after a user spends a specific amount of time on a page.
Click an element
Show the survey after a user clicks a button, link, or any element.
Time spent in session
Show the survey after a user spends a specific amount of time in a session.
Scroll depth
Show the survey after a user scrolls a specific distance on a page.
Exit intent
Show the survey when a user is about to leave the page.
Pages in a session
Show the survey after a user browses a specific number of pages.
Custom triggers
Trigger surveys through custom JavaScript calls - fire on any user action or event.
Combine multiple triggers
Scroll depth > 80% + Exit Intent - target people who are interested but about to leave.
Know which user gave
what feedback
Trusted by over 100+ Startups worldwide
What makes in-product surveys different
Behavioral triggers
Fire surveys after specific user actions - not random timers. Ask right when users have something to say.
User identity linking
Every response is tied to a real user - name, plan, role, signup date. No more anonymous averages.
Segment by plan or role
Filter NPS, CSAT, and PMF scores by free vs paid, admin vs viewer, or any custom attribute you define.
Auto NPS, CSAT, PMF scoring
Built-in templates with automatic score calculation. No spreadsheets, no manual tallying.